Contract Negotiating Committee

A standing committee of at least three regular members who are elected at the first general meeting of the year. The committee manages the course and conduct of negotiations with the bargaining agent for the employer.

About CCFA

Your Union represents the voices of over 600 continuing and term members employed at Camosun College. We support and advocate for your employment rights under our collective agreement and seek to improve your working conditions through collective bargaining.
